That'a a lot more meat than was left on my Brembos after 1 day at the Glen (4 half hour sessions). I also had significant taper. Leading edge was maybe half of that. Trailing end was roughly the same as your pic. (I'd post a pic, but they went in the trash the day after I returned)

Not sure if the Hawks would wear more evenly or not. Certainly going to give them a go...

Stock rotors are holding up surprisingly well...
I never ran my stock Brembo pads at high speed tracks. Ran them at M1, Nelson Ledges and Waterford Hills. They lasted forever there. As soon as I was running Brainerd and Road America I was running the Hawk DTC 60 and 70 pads. Normally the 70 pads at Brainerd had good life left after 2 days, but I'm wearing through them faster as I add more tire and downforce to the car and use the brakes harder and harder.
I need more cooling to help with pad temps. Fluid temp is less of an issue it seems, as I'm using titanium shims behind the pads and the front pistons are also titanium on the Viper calipers. Pedal never feels mushy if I bleed them well (meaning no mistakes with ABS purge, etc.) before a track weekend.

I have been lucky and have not seen anyone go off in Turn 1 or 2 at Brainerd Donnybrook in my sessions, but most other turns I've seen offs or spins.
I know if it was a race this car could go at least a little faster than 130 in Turn 1, but it's as fast as I want to go in my street car. It's close enough to a racing speed for me.
What I have to focus on is getting on the throttle sooner in a lot of the corners. Acceleration is what this car does best and in many places it's better to sacrifice some corner speed or to brake a little sooner to get on the gas sooner.
